E60 (2004 - 2010)
BMW 5-Series (E60 chassis) was first seen in the Unites States in the fall of 2003 with a 2004 Model Year designation. The E60 is now available as a 528i, 528xi, 535i, 535xi, 550i and a 535xi sports wagon! -- View the E60 Wiki |

MTEC bulbs are great and cheaper than HID's. I tried HID's in my fogs and the drivers side bulb didnt fit because of the windshield washer fluid reservoir...
The HID bulbs came straignt out and the wires became cramped. The oem size bulbs are an L shape and you need the same style fitment... Last edited by Meccamotorsport; 10-13-2011 at 05:54 PM. |
